基于ubuntu server 20.04安装ERPNEXT
date
Oct 15, 2021
slug
25
status
Published
tags
Website
Linux
ERP
summary
type
Post
Property
URL
1.服务器准备
1. 准备一台装好ubuntu20.04的服务器,本地虚拟机或者云服务器皆可,虚拟机的网络要用桥接模式。Ubuntu 20.04server安装会顺利些。
2. 设置root密码(虚拟机、物理机、腾讯云需要做这一步,阿里云在初始化镜像时设置的是root用户和密码,不用做这一步,其他未测试,需视情况而定。)
3. 添加用户(虚拟机、物理机、腾讯云可以略过这一步,其中虚拟机和物理机可以使用安装系统时建的用户,腾讯云可以用ubuntu用户 ,阿里云需要做这一步)
4. 将用户设置sudo权限:(如跳过第3步则这步也可以跳过)
5. 通过ssh登录root用户
修改好按ESC,shift+:,输入wq回车
重启服务
/etc/init.d/ssh restart
2.替换国内镜像源并安装依赖
下面用的是清华的镜像源,操作如下(root用户可不输入sudo,国内的云服务器都预置有各自的源镜像,可以不用做这一步):
1.备份
2.修改
# 默认注释了源码镜像以提高 apt update 速度,如有需要可自行取消注释 de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al main restricted universe multiverse # de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al main restricted universe multiverse de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-updates main restricted universe multiverse # de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-updates main restricted universe multiverse de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-backports main restricted universe multiverse # de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-backports main restricted universe multiverse de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-security main restricted universe multiverse # de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-security main restricted universe multiverse # 预发布软件源,不建议启用 # deb https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-proposed main restricted universe multiverse # deb-src https://mirrors.tuna.tsinghua.edu.cn/ubuntu/ focal-proposed main restricted universe multiverse
3. 更新并重启
3.下载node.js
4. 安装操作系统级依赖
5. 数据库配置
用nano编辑my.cnf文件
6. 安装yarn
7.安装bench
8. 安装erpnext
9.虚拟机防火墙设置
如果是虚似机安装,需要防火墙入站打开80端口。
10.安装打印wkhtmltopdf 库
11.登录
用浏览器(推荐 Chrome或Firefox)输入IP或域名,登录系统,用户名administrator,密码是admin-password的密码。
**附注:安装中国本地化APP**
1. 获取APP
2. 安装APP
**常见问题**
1. wkhtmltopdf安装时出现字体库依赖无法安装等错误
参考了这个https://askubuntu.com/questions/604029/dependency-problems-with-wkhtmltopdf-when-trying-to-install-latest-version,最后是以下命令解决了
2. 通过打印转PDF时出现乱码
参考这个帖子https://www.taodudu.cc/news/show-1772808.html,用以下命令安装字体